[Studies on chemical constituents of Heterosmilax yunnanensis]

Zhong Yao Cai. 2007 Aug;30(8):959-61.
[Article in Chinese]

Abstract

Objective: To study the chemical constituents of Heterosmilax yunianensis.

Methods: The compounds were isolated and repeatedly purified with chromatograph and the structures were elucidated by physico-chemical properties and spectral analysis.

Results: Eight compounds were obtained and elucidated as beta-sitosterol (I), glycerol monopalmitate (II), daucosterol (IIl), hexacosanoic acid (IV), 5-hydroxymethyl furaldehyde (V), hergapen (VI), ursolic acid (VII), liquiritigenin (VIII).

Conclusion: They have been isolated from this plant for the first time, and IV - VIII are obtained from the plants of Heterosmilax for the first time.
